On Thursday, the AMAs announced who's nominated — and first-time nominee Olivia Rodrigo leads the list with seven categories. The Weeknd follows with six while Bad Bunny, Doja Cat and Giveon are tied with five nods each. The Sour songstress, 18, is nominated in the artist, favorite female pop artist and new artist of the year, while her song "drivers license" is up for favorite trending song, music video and pop song. Also, her album Sour is up favorite pop album. Rodrigo could break the record for most wins for a first-time nominee if she earns five of her seven awards. (Olivia Newton-John and Justin Bieber are tied for the record at four each.) Along with Rodrigo, Ariana Grande, BTS, Drake, The Weeknd and Taylor Swift — who won last year — are up for artist of the year. In the male pop artist category, 2020 winner Justin Bieber faces off against Ed Sheeran, Drake, Lil Nas X and The Weeknd. Meanwhile, last year's female pop artist Swift is up against Rodrigo, Grande, Doja Cat and Dua Lipa. Along with his artist and male pop artist of the year nominations, The Weeknd is also up for favorite male R&B artist, along with favorite music video and favorite pop song for "Save Your Tears" and favorite Latin song for his "Hawái" collaboration with Maluma. And Swift, who took home three awards last year, may once again break her own record for most AMA wins of all time. She currently holds the record with 32 wins. Among first-time nominees, Rodrigo is joined by the likes of Giveon, Kali Uchis, Saweetie and 24kGoldn. Last year, Swift, Bieber, The Weeknd and Dan + Shay tied for the most awards won, with three each.
